-#
-# reproducible_build.bbclass
-#
-# This bbclass is mainly responsible to determine SOURCE_DATE_EPOCH on a per recipe base.
-# We need to set a recipe specific SOURCE_DATE_EPOCH in each recipe environment for various tasks.
-# One way would be to modify all recipes one-by-one to specify SOURCE_DATE_EPOCH explicitly,
-# but that is not realistic as there are hundreds (probably thousands) of recipes in various meta-layers.
-# Therefore we do it this class.
-# After sources are unpacked but before they are patched, we try to determine the value for SOURCE_DATE_EPOCH.
-#
-# There are 4 ways to determine SOURCE_DATE_EPOCH:
-#
-# 1. Use value from __source_date_epoch.txt file if this file exists.
-# This file was most likely created in the previous build by one of the following methods 2,3,4.
-# In principle, it could actually provided by a recipe via SRC_URI
-#
-# If the file does not exist, first try to determine the value for SOURCE_DATE_EPOCH:
-#
-# 2. If we detected a folder .git, use .git last commit date timestamp, as git does not allow checking out
-# files and preserving their timestamps.
-#
-# 3. Use the mtime of "known" files such as NEWS, CHANGLELOG, ...
-# This will work fine for any well kept repository distributed via tarballs.
-#
-# 4. If the above steps fail, we need to check all package source files and use the youngest file of the source tree.
-#
-# Once the value of SOURCE_DATE_EPOCH is determined, it is stored in the recipe ${WORKDIR}/source_date_epoch folder
-# in a text file "__source_date_epoch.txt'. If this file is found by other recipe task, the value is exported in
-# the SOURCE_DATE_EPOCH variable in the task environment. This is done in an anonymous python function,
-# so SOURCE_DATE_EPOCH is guaranteed to exist for all tasks the may use it (do_configure, do_compile, do_package, ...)

-BUILD_REPRODUCIBLE_BINARIES ??= '1'
-inherit ${@oe.utils.ifelse(d.getVar('BUILD_REPRODUCIBLE_BINARIES') == '1', 'reproducible_build_simple', '')}
-
-SDE_DIR ="${WORKDIR}/source-date-epoch"
-SDE_FILE = "${SDE_DIR}/__source_date_epoch.txt"
-
-SSTATETASKS += "do_deploy_source_date_epoch"
-
-do_deploy_source_date_epoch () {
- echo "Deploying SDE to ${SDE_DIR}."
-}
-
-python do_deploy_source_date_epoch_setscene () {
- sstate_setscene(d)
-}
-
-do_deploy_source_date_epoch[dirs] = "${SDE_DIR}"
-do_deploy_source_date_epoch[sstate-plaindirs] = "${SDE_DIR}"
-addtask do_deploy_source_date_epoch_setscene
-addtask do_deploy_source_date_epoch before do_configure after do_patch
-
-def get_source_date_epoch_known_files(d, path):
- source_date_epoch = 0
- known_files = set(["NEWS", "ChangeLog", "Changelog", "CHANGES"])
- for file in known_files:
- filepath = os.path.join(path,file)
- if os.path.isfile(filepath):
- mtime = int(os.path.getmtime(filepath))
- # There may be more than one "known_file" present, if so, use the youngest one
- if mtime > source_date_epoch:
- source_date_epoch = mtime
- return source_date_epoch
-
-def find_git_folder(path):
- exclude = set(["temp", "license-destdir", "patches", "recipe-sysroot-native", "recipe-sysroot", "pseudo", "build", "image", "sysroot-destdir"])
- for root, dirs, files in os.walk(path, topdown=True):
- dirs[:] = [d for d in dirs if d not in exclude]
- if '.git' in dirs:
- #bb.warn("found root:%s" % (str(root)))
- return root
-
-def get_source_date_epoch_git(d, path):
- source_date_epoch = 0
- if "git://" in d.getVar('SRC_URI'):
- gitpath = find_git_folder(d.getVar('WORKDIR'))
- if gitpath != None:
- import subprocess
- if os.path.isdir(os.path.join(gitpath,".git")):
- try:
- source_date_epoch = int(subprocess.check_output(['git','log','-1','--pretty=%ct'], cwd=path))
- #bb.warn("JB *** gitpath:%s sde: %d" % (gitpath,source_date_epoch))
- bb.debug(1, "git repo path:%s sde: %d" % (gitpath,source_date_epoch))
- except subprocess.CalledProcessError as grepexc:
- #bb.warn( "Expected git repository not found, (path: %s) error:%d" % (gitpath, grepexc.returncode))
- bb.debug(1, "Expected git repository not found, (path: %s) error:%d" % (gitpath, grepexc.returncode))
- else:
- bb.warn("Failed to find a git repository for path:%s" % (path))
- return source_date_epoch
-
-python do_create_source_date_epoch_stamp() {
- path = d.getVar('S')
- if not os.path.isdir(path):
- bb.warn("Unable to determine source_date_epoch! path:%s" % path)
- return
-
- epochfile = d.getVar('SDE_FILE')
- if os.path.isfile(epochfile):
- bb.debug(1, " path: %s reusing __source_date_epoch.txt" % epochfile)
- return
-
- # Try to detect/find a git repository
- source_date_epoch = get_source_date_epoch_git(d, path)
- if source_date_epoch == 0:
- source_date_epoch = get_source_date_epoch_known_files(d, path)
- if source_date_epoch == 0:
- # Do it the hard way: check all files and find the youngest one...
- filename_dbg = None
- exclude = set(["temp", "license-destdir", "patches", "recipe-sysroot-native", "recipe-sysroot", "pseudo", "build", "image", "sysroot-destdir"])
- for root, dirs, files in os.walk(path, topdown=True):
- files = [f for f in files if not f[0] == '.']
- dirs[:] = [d for d in dirs if d not in exclude]
-
- for fname in files:
- filename = os.path.join(root, fname)
- try:
- mtime = int(os.path.getmtime(filename))
- except ValueError:
- mtime = 0
- if mtime > source_date_epoch:
- source_date_epoch = mtime
- filename_dbg = filename
-
- if filename_dbg != None:
- bb.debug(1," SOURCE_DATE_EPOCH %d derived from: %s" % (source_date_epoch, filename_dbg))
-
- if source_date_epoch == 0:
- # empty folder, not a single file ...
- # kernel source do_unpack is special cased
- if not bb.data.inherits_class('kernel', d):
- bb.debug(1, "Unable to determine source_date_epoch! path:%s" % path)
-
- bb.utils.mkdirhier(d.getVar('SDE_DIR'))
- with open(epochfile, 'w') as f:
- f.write(str(source_date_epoch))
-}
-
-BB_HASHBASE_WHITELIST += "SOURCE_DATE_EPOCH"
-
-python () {
- if d.getVar('BUILD_REPRODUCIBLE_BINARIES') == '1':
- d.appendVarFlag("do_unpack", "postfuncs", " do_create_source_date_epoch_stamp")
- epochfile = d.getVar('SDE_FILE')
- source_date_epoch = "0"
- if os.path.isfile(epochfile):
- with open(epochfile, 'r') as f:
- source_date_epoch = f.read()
- bb.debug(1, "source_date_epoch stamp found ---> stamp %s" % source_date_epoch)
- d.setVar('SOURCE_DATE_EPOCH', source_date_epoch)
-}
